Why Live in Kings Oak

Kings Oak, a small neighborhood in St. Louis with fewer than 80 homes, is known for century-old homes and tree-lined sidewalks. The area is highly walkable and close to attractions, parks and shopping. The neighborhood's historic homes, primarily Dutch Colonial Revivals, bungalows and Craftsman styles, date back to the early 1900s. The small community hosts regular events, such as neighborhood cleanups and themed celebrations at the St. Louis Science Center. Residents enjoy a peaceful atmosphere despite being close to bustling neighborhoods and Forest Park. The 1,300-acre urban park has miles of trails, museums, a golf course and the St. Louis Zoo, as well as sports courts and fields. Tower Grove Park and the Missouri Botanical Garden offer additional things to do outside, less than 2 miles from the neighborhood. Local eateries include Modern Brewery, which serves house-brewed beers, and The Kings Oak restaurant, known for its eclectic menu. For more dining and entertainment options, The Grove is three miles northeast, with a variety of quirky restaurants and live performance venues. The Hill, an Italian neighborhood with rich history and cuisine, is just a mile south. The St. Louis Galleria, five miles west, has over 100 stores. St. Louis University High School is a private all-boys high school in the neighborhood, earning an A rating from Niche. Buses stop along Oakland and Manchester avenues, heading a few miles east to Downtown St. Louis. Interstates 64 and 44 are conveniently close to home, but bring with them the noise of passing cars.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Kings Oak a good place to live?
Kings Oak is a good place to live. Kings Oak is considered very car-dependent and bikeable with some transit options. Kings Oak is a suburban neighborhood. Kings Oak has 7 parks for recreational activities. It is sparse in population with 1.0 people per acre and a median age of 34. The average household income is $83,783 which is below the national average. College graduates make up 59.8% of residents. A majority of residents in Kings Oak are renters, with 83.8% of residents renting and 16.2% of residents owning their home. Is Kings Oak, MO a safe neighborhood?
Kings Oak, MO is less safe than the average neighborhood in the United States. It received a crime score of 7 out of 10.
How much do you need to make to afford a house in Kings Oak?
The median home price in Kings Oak is $389,000. If you put a 20% down payment of $77,800 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.1%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$1,890 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$81K a year to afford the median home price in Kings Oak. Learn how much home you can afford with our Home Affordability Calculator. The average household income in Kings Oak is $84K.
